8th Grade AP Language Composition is an accelerated course that teaches rhetoric, argumentation, and persuasive writing techniques typically covered in AP Language and Composition. Students in 8th grade who take this course develop advanced critical reading and writing skills earlier than their peers, positioning them well for high school AP courses and standardized tests. It's ideal for strong writers who want to challenge themselves and build a foundation in analyzing how language shapes meaning and persuades audiences.
The biggest hurdles include mastering rhetorical analysis (identifying and explaining an author's techniques), moving beyond surface-level writing to sophisticated argumentation, and managing the reading load of complex texts. Many students also struggle with time management when analyzing passages under pressure and distinguishing between different rhetorical strategies. Additionally, transitioning to academic writing standards—proper evidence integration, precise vocabulary, and logical organization—can feel overwhelming at first.
A tutor can break down complex rhetorical concepts into manageable steps, provide targeted feedback on your essays before they're graded, and teach you test-taking strategies specific to timed AP-style prompts. They'll help you identify your personal writing weaknesses—whether it's thesis clarity, evidence selection, or argument structure—and create a focused practice plan. Regular one-on-1 instruction also builds confidence in analyzing difficult texts and developing your unique analytical voice.

Practice tests and timed writing are essential because they simulate real test conditions and help you develop pacing skills—managing your time to read passages carefully, plan your response, and write a strong essay within the time limit. Regular practice also helps you become familiar with question formats and rhetorical patterns you'll encounter. A tutor can review your practice essays, point out what's working, and help you refine your approach before tackling actual assessments.
